Transaction bb66030598fde272fe3514f54a3b77d9951851130a6f2c0091811a21d07298e5
1 Input
1 Output
-
bb66030598fde272fe3514f54a3b77d9951851130a6f2c0091811a21d07298e5:0
- value
- 82200
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f9155c9e4ea1c7c51c4c33092da2497e4a2d2573cafb56e01b6b1fd8a9be9710
- address
- tb1ply24e8jw58ru28zvxvyjmgjf0e9z6ftneta4dcqmdv0a32d7jugq4q20zr